Note: Along track, cross track, and radial components (in meters) from 16 hours of orbital overlap with
      previous day. Zero values indicate no overlap available.
      * indicates that the satellite is in eclipse sometime during that day.

Remarks: (1) Starting GPS week 0765, we are reporting only global products in
             this bulletin.  PGGA results will appear in a separate bulletin.
         (2) Using ITRF93 reference frame since GPS Week 782 (1 January 1995)
